    Are 81 and 82 650 shock's the same. And other shock ?

    This is the adjustable dampening at the top of the shock, shock. The part number's are different for the 81 and 82 GS 650 G's. But the 81 has a chrome dial top, and the 82 has a black. Surely they would be the same shock,,,I'm guessing. I'm thinking the difference is because of the chrome/black adjuster.

    Anyone know for sure. Or at least want to back up my guess.

    Also. These newly acquired shock's I got has the foam dampener, foamy thingy,, like a bump stop on it. It was falling apart so I took it off. Should I maybe split a grommet and put on there, or don't worry about it. Thanks.

          #5
          Yes, those are bumpers in case the shock comes close to bottoming out. If they are not there a resounding metal clang would be heard instead.
